计及角度不对称的配电网负荷不对称线损分析

摘    要:针对当前研究配电网三相负荷不对称对线损的影响仅仅局限于三相大小不对称的情况,提出计及角度不对称的配电网三相不对称对线损有影响。通过分析三相不平衡线路的线损,用全电流经坐标变换的方法研究了计及角度不对称时的三相不平衡对线损的影响,推导出了线损增加率与相不平衡度的关系公式,并给出了配网中常见几种负荷不对称时的线损分析结果。通过对现场实测数据进行算例分析,结果表明考虑角度不对称时的线损增加率更接近于真实值,对准确地计算配电网中的线损更有指导意义。

关 键 词:配电网  不平衡度  线损增加率  角度不对称

Line Loss Analysis of Three-phase Unbalanced Circuit with Angle Asymmetry

Abstract:At present,the studies of line loss affected by the three-phase do not consider angle asymmetry.So,theoretical line losses are different from statistical line losses.The condition that circuit loss is affected by the three-phase unbalanced circuit with angle asymmetry is studied in the method of full current transformed after the coordinates.Then the relational formula of line-loss increment rate and unbalanced degrees of phases is deduced.What is more,the exceptional cases of line-loss increment rate which is caused by the three-phase load unbalanced distribution is offered.The numerical result with a test indicates that when the angle asymmetry is considered,it approaches the realistic value nearer and is a better method to accurately compute the rate of circuit loss in power distribution systems.
Keywords:distribution network  unbalance degree  increment rate of line loss  angle asymmetry
